Decaf without the dullness. Still Kicking proves that you can still enjoy full flavor even without caffeine. A humorous nod to the kick of coffee, but with a clear message: the taste remains, the caffeine does not.

Still Kicking Woodcups are certified with the Rainforest Alliance certification, which stands for responsible farming and fairer working conditions.

These sustainable coffee pods, made from wood chips, are 100% biodegradable. This means you can simply dispose of the pods with your organic waste after use!

Our journey towards ethical coffee

Transparency doesn't happen overnight. We're working in phases towards a fully honest and transparent coffee chain. Each step brings us closer to direct collaboration with farmers and a fair price for everyone in the chain.

Phase 1: Awareness and foundation

We source from Dutch roasters that work with certifications such as Rainforest Alliance, Fairtrade, and Organic. This phase focuses on awareness: we raise attention to the problem while guaranteeing high-quality coffee.

Phase 2: Beginning of direct sourcing

We start building our own relationships with farmers. The more people choose Bunafide, the more we can invest in this step. This lays the foundation for true transparency and direct trade.

Phase 3: Direct purchasing

We now purchase directly from farmers in Ethiopia and Kenya. The chain becomes shorter, and price distribution fairer. Consumers pay a little more, but know exactly where that difference goes. This is the step where we truly make an impact visible.

Phase 4: Making the process more sustainable

Once the direct chain is established, we focus on sustainability. From packaging materials to local projects with farmers. We invest in better working conditions, nature conservation, and sustainable growth.

Phase 5: Long-term change

In the long term, we want to support multiple farmers and strengthen local communities. Not only through fair trade, but also by investing in the future of the villages and the surrounding nature.

Composition and origin

Still Kicking Woodcups are made from 100% Arabica beans, sourced from Colombia, the same beans as our Still Kicking coffee beans. As decaf coffee pods, these are the only caffeine-free woodcups in our range.

Flavor profile and roast

These medium roast coffee pods have a sweet and fruity flavour profile and are very mild in taste. The decaffeination process does not alter the origin or roast, so the taste remains virtually the same as our regular Still Kicking coffee beans.

Who are the Still Kicking woodcups for?

Still Kicking Woodcups are Nespresso Compatible, making them suitable for any time you want to quickly and easily make a cup of coffee, including in the evening, thanks to being caffeine-free. After use, simply dispose of the cup with your organic waste.
